Prep roundup: Palmetto Ridge softball wins CCAC title with victory over Lely

The Palmetto Ridge High School softball team beat Lely 6-2 on the road Thursday night, winning the Collier County Athletic Conference title.

The Bears overcame a 2-1 deficit in the top of the seventh inning with a two-run single by Markie Rosenbalm and a two-run double by Sami Hamilton-Creel.

Baylee Haggard picked up the win, allowing two runs on 10 hits, while striking out three in seven innings.

"Wow what a game on Lely's Senior Night," Palmetto Ridge coach Brian Creel said. "I want to thank head coach Rich Costante and Lely softball for also recognizing our seniors, a real class act."

Palmetto Ridge (14-9) hosts St. John Neumann on Friday at 6 p.m.

SEACREST 13, COMMUNITY SCHOOL OF NAPLES 4: Ryleigh Howell led the Stingrays with four hits. Annabelle Melo hit a double and a triple, while Emily Wisser and Jay Toledo each had two hits for Seacrest.

Katey Ryan picked up the win, pitching five innings.

BASEBALL

ST. JOHN NEUMANN 12, COMMUNITY CHRISTIAN 2: St. John Neumann scored 11 runs on 10 hits in the top of the sixth inning to secure the victory.

Sean Lyons led the Celtics, hitting three doubles, including two RBIs. Thomas Balboni hit a pair singles, a double, had two RBIs and scored two runs. Pierre Eaton and Blaine Major also had multiple hits and combined to score three runs.

Marcon Harding picked up the win, facing four batters in 1 1/3 innings.

St. John Neumann (17-4) hosts Southwest Florida Christian on Friday at 4 p.m.

SEACREST 8, LELY 2: Erick Chavez led the Stingrays, hitting three singles and recording four RBIs. Lenny Pietersz hit a pair of singles, was walked and had two RBIs.

Matt DiNorcia picked up the win, surrendering one hit in four innings of relief.

Seacrest (15-8) is at Riverdale on Tuesday at 7 p.m.
